Output 609d539a21081a003aee4e49ef764bbc8171095e974eb2ffbfff5d353581f642:155

value
49573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be3a7ca102231899a76ea33498de9c28c83cdf2 OP_EQUAL
address
34EUtVvjASqzxtmK54T5GiiEnGE9ZxaweM
transaction
609d539a21081a003aee4e49ef764bbc8171095e974eb2ffbfff5d353581f642